Output 8b70db8224eb019c82b55b5d039b5bf577e90dd53bb720372e3b10f9fb43695a:1

value
511669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 043071ac142bed0fba67685c913e9ad5e52da5f5 OP_EQUAL
address
325AfG7gtr2B3UGK6e9Brz7nQJmfVtGVnH
transaction
8b70db8224eb019c82b55b5d039b5bf577e90dd53bb720372e3b10f9fb43695a
spent
true